Abstract

The invention relates to the field of construction technology, in particular to water sealing consolidation equipment of a cast-in-place pile soil body and a construction technology thereof. The water sealing consolidation equipment of the cast-in-place pile soil body comprises a drilling machine, a drilling pipe, a high pressure hose, a grouting pump and a grouting pipe and is characterized in that the grouting pump is connected to the grouting pipe by the high pressure hose; being detachable, the drilling pipe is connected with and driven by the drilling machine; the drilling pipe is internally provided with the grouting pipe; in the invention, a pile border grouting pipe and a pile center grouting pipe are employed to inject cement paste meeting certain requirements into soil body at the periphery of the cast-in-place pile, so that the soil body at the periphery of the cast-in-place pile is equipped with water sealing property and consolidated. In the invention, slurry wall protection or cement wall protection processes are completely omitted, as a result, excavation quality of the cast-in-place pile can be ensured, construction difficulty of pore-forming is greatly reduced, underwater cement pouring construction is avoided, difficulty of pouring the cast-in-place pile body cement is lowered and quality of pouring the cast-in-place pile body cement is ensured. On the whole, construction progress is accelerated and economic benefits are remarkably improved.

Description

A kind of water sealing consolidation equipment of cast-in-place pile soil body and job practices
Technical field:
The present invention relates to the realm of building construction, particularly a kind of water sealing consolidation equipment of cast-in-place pile soil body and construction technology.
Technical background:
When abundant and transmission coefficient carries out filling pile construction under greater than the geological conditions of the soil layer of 10-2cm/s at bury, silt, recent deposit cohesive soil, sand or underground water, because the soil body utmost point built on the sand, perhaps rich groundwater, when adopting mechanical hole building, need to adopt mud off, when adopting the manual pore-forming, need to adopt concrete guard wall, the problems such as landslide occur in digging process to avoid a hole.When adopting mud off, in order to ensure the cast-in-place pile concrete casting quality, also must adopt the underwater concreting technology.No matter adopt which kind of method construction, all have the outstanding problem that efficiency of construction is low, construction quality is difficult to guarantee.
Summary of the invention:
The object of the invention is to, a kind of water sealing consolidation equipment and construction technology of cast-in-place pile soil body is provided, the increase of castinplace pile periphery soil strength, compressibilty are reduced, simultaneously, impermeability, the stability of the soil body all are greatly improved.
For realizing the purpose of foregoing invention, the invention provides following technical scheme:
A kind of water sealing consolidation equipment of cast-in-place pile soil body, comprise rig, drilling rod, high-pressure rubber pipe, grouting pump and Grouting Pipe, it is characterized in that, grouting pump is connected on the Grouting Pipe by high-pressure rubber pipe, drilling rod links to each other with rig, tend to act by rig, detachable, Grouting Pipe is equipped with in drilling rod inside, exceptionally two kinds of Grouting Pipe: a kind of is stake limit Grouting Pipe,, in pipe end beginning 1.55m length range, be parallel on the tube wall direction in the tube wall lower end, three row's injected holes are arranged, every row has six holes, the diameter of the every round in both sides is 20mm, is called tangential injected hole, and the diameter of middle round is 3mm, be called the radial grouting hole, tube wall surface is carved with the vertical center line of intermediate radial injected hole, and the axle center angle of adjacent two rounds is 67.5 °, and the vertical distance of every each Kong Kongxin of row is 300mm; Another kind is stake heart Grouting Pipe, in the tube wall lower end in pipe end beginning 150mm length range, be parallel on the tube wall direction, eight row's injected holes are arranged, every row has two injected holes, and the diameter in hole is 20mm, and the vertical distance of two Kong Kongxin is 100mm, be called the normal direction injected hole, the normal direction injected hole distributes around even tube wall.
A kind of water sealing consolidation construction technology of cast-in-place pile soil body, its main technical schemes is: utilize stake limit Grouting Pipe of the present invention and stake heart Grouting Pipe to inject in the castinplace pile periphery soil body and meet necessarily required cement paste, make the castinplace pile periphery soil body have the sealing characteristic, and reinforced.Its job practices is: (stake limit Grouting Pipe and a pile heart Grouting Pipe are injected cement paste respectively in the vertical of castinplace pile periphery and the bottom soil body by eight, make cement paste with filling, infiltration, the mode such as compacted, be combined with soil body particle, after the sclerosis, formation has cup-shaped cylindrical shell water stopping function, firm in the vertical of castinplace pile periphery and the bottom soil body.
Work progress of the present invention is finished like this:
1) first measuring goes out to intend the concentric circles of the castinplace pile of excavation, its diameter is greater than castinplace pile diameter 200mm~500mm, mechanical type when concrete numerical value depends on castinplace pile borehole in the future, different boring machines, corresponding pore-forming accuracy is different, the desirable low numerical value that pore-forming accuracy is high, the desirable high numerical value that pore-forming accuracy is low, then measuring goes out the circumscribed octagon of this circle, take each summit of this octagon as the center of circle, utilize rig to connect Φ 42 geologic drilling rods respectively, bore eight stake limit grout holes, stake limit grout hole is than the dark 200mm~400mm of castinplace pile, and the concrete visual groundwater run off situation of numerical value is suitably selected.Geologic drilling rod has the sleeve pipe function simultaneously, 38 limit Grouting Pipe of one whole Φ of geologic drilling rod inner sleeve, after stake limit grout hole gets into projected depth, adjust stake marginal not slurry tube angulation, make radial hole meta groove on the marginal not slurry tube wall over against the castinplace pile center of circle, then reverse geologic drilling rod, make it to extract out ground, stake limit Grouting Pipe is stayed in the grout hole, prepared slip casting.In like manner, at the castinplace pile home position, utilize rig to connect Φ 42 geologic drilling rods (interior lag pile heart Grouting Pipe) and bore stake heart grout hole, the dark 200mm~400mm of hole depth rate castinplace pile, the concrete visual groundwater run off situation of numerical value is suitably selected;
2) with domestic fresh water and strength grade be 32.5 Portland cement mix and stir into cement paste (when the diameter of castinplace pile is not more than 1.2m or the degree of depth and is not more than 15m) or 42.5 (when the diameter of castinplace pile greater than 1.2m or the degree of depth during greater than 15m) Portland cement mix and stir into cement paste, the water/binder ratio of cement paste (mass ratio of mixing water and cement) can be between 8: 1 to 1: 1 flexible choice (be no more than 1 hour and be advisable to guarantee every period slip casting deadline).Utilize grouting pump, cement paste is injected one by one the soil layer hole of castinplace pile periphery or bottom by Grouting Pipe; The grouting pressure of grouting pump is controlled at 0.3~0.6MPa, with the slip casting length that guarantees the tangential injected hole on each limit Grouting Pipe in 0.5m~1.5m, slip casting length corresponding control in 0.5m~1.5m of the normal direction injected hole of radial grouting length on 0.3m~0.5m, stake heart Grouting Pipe in radial grouting hole;
3) segmentation from bottom to top of whole slip casting process is carried out continuously, and one section grouting amount controlling value of every pile limit Grouting Pipe is: π (0.150m) 2(L (the external octagon length of side)+0.3m), to annotate in the cement paste adding grouting pump of one section slurry institute, at the bottom of the grout hole of stake limit, begin slip casting first, until this section of cement paste cement paste has been annotated, utilize rig to promote stake limit Grouting Pipe to next slip casting section, hoisting depth is 1500mm, to guarantee the hypomere cement paste and to combine the last period, then carry out next section slip casting, to the last promote also slip casting and arrive till the position, aperture; One section slip casting that stake heart Grouting Pipe is disposable to be finished at the bottom of the heart grout hole get final product, and grouting amount is: π [D (castinplace pile radius)+(0.2~0.5m, by actual institute value calmly)] 20.2m;
4) after stake limit grout hole is finished slip casting, utilize cement paste to block grout hole;
5) along with the finishing of each grout hole slip casting and sealing of hole, the cement paste that is injected by each grout hole is connected as a single entity, and after the sclerosis, forms in the vertical of castinplace pile periphery and the bottom soil body and has circular cup-shaped cylindrical shell water stopping function, firm.
In theory, circumscribed regular polygon can be from five limits until odd plots of land that can be cultivated, but consider the convenience of in-site measurement unwrapping wire, the best stress form of cement slurry and the principles such as economy of work progress, octagon is preferred.From measuring the unwrapping wire angle, quadrangle or octagon are the easiest accurately, quickly measuring out; From loading angle, the limit number is more, and polygon is near circle, and its stress form is got over science, and because slurry mainly bears pressure, its supporting capacity obtains optimal utilization; If but the limit is too many, drilling hole amount has just increased, and has increased workload, the limit very little, slurry profile and circular error are too large, slurry is when bearing pressure, the inwall interlude is also wanted bearing tension, this is the stressed weak link of plain-water slurry.Mixed economy factor and supporting capacity factor consider, octagon is optimal selection.
As a same reason, the row of the injected hole on the stake heart Grouting Pipe can be called the normal direction injected hole for six to ten rows, and the normal direction injected hole distributes around even tube wall.Adjust the row of normal direction injected hole according to the size of castinplace pile diameter, the castinplace pile diameter is large, can suitably increase the row of injected hole; The castinplace pile diameter is little, can suitably reduce the row of injected hole, take reach can make cement paste be covered with the cup-shaped cylindrical shell the bottom as purpose.Wherein eight rows are optimal selection.
Different according to the geological condition of reality, can align polygonal summit according to actual needs and adjust, might not require is regular polygon completely; Polygon also can be selected to decagon on five limits.When selecting the different edge number, corresponding adjustment need to be done in the position of injected hole on the Grouting Pipe of stake limit, and the tangential injected hole on the Grouting Pipe of stake limit need to face two adjacent polygon vertexs.
Operating principle of the present invention is, utilizes grouting pump, Grouting Pipe, around castinplace pile outline position, cement paste injected the abundant and transmission coefficient of bury, silt, recent deposit cohesive soil, sand or underground water equably greater than 10 -2In the soil body of cm/s, with filling, infiltration and the mode such as compacted, drive away moisture and gas between soil particle, and fill its position, form a cup-shaped cement paste soil mass consolidation that intensity is large, compressibilty is low, the impermeability is high and have good stability after the sclerosis, cast-in-place pile soil body is wrapped in wherein, further constructs for castinplace pile and create good condition.
Adopt more at present mud off or concrete guard wall, even further need adopt coagulation placingJi Shu under water, the present invention has omitted mud off or concrete guard wall operation fully, can guarantee the priming concrete pile hole excavation quality, greatly reduces the difficulty of construction of pore-forming; Avoid the underwater concreting construction, reduce perfusion pour stake body by concrete difficulty, guarantee to pour into the pour stake body by concrete quality.On the whole, accelerating construction progress significantly improves economic benefit.

The specific embodiment:
Below in conjunction with accompanying drawing the present invention is further specified.
By Fig. 1-7 as can be known, elder generation's measuring goes out to intend the concentric circles of the castinplace pile of excavation, its diameter is greater than castinplace pile diameter 200mm, then measuring goes out the circumscribed octagon of this circle, respectively take each summit of this octagon as the center of circle, utilize rig 1 to connect Φ 42 geologic drilling rods 5, bore eight stake limit grout holes 4, stake limit grout hole 4 is than the dark 200mm of castinplace pile, geologic drilling rod is double, and to make cover effective, and 38 limit Grouting Pipe 6 of one whole Φ of geologic drilling rod 5 inner sleeves are after stake limit grout hole 4 gets into projected depth, adjust stake limit Grouting Pipe 6 angles, make radial hole meta groove 9 on the marginal not slurry tube wall over against the castinplace pile center of circle, radial grouting hole 7 and tangential injected hole 8 are aimed at intended the slip casting positions, then reverse geologic drilling rod 5 and extract it out ground, stake limit Grouting Pipe 6 is stayed in the grout hole, prepared slip casting.In like manner, at the castinplace pile home position, utilize rig 1 to connect Φ 42 geologic drilling rods 5 (interior lag pile heart Grouting Pipe 11) and bore stake heart grout hole 10, hole depth also requires than the dark 200mm of castinplace pile.
Behind the pore-forming, be that 32.5 or 42.5 Portland cement mixes and stirs into cement paste 13 with domestic fresh water and strength grade, the water/binder ratio of cement paste (mass ratio of mixing water and cement) can be between 8: 1 to 1: 1 flexible choice (be no more than 1 hour and be advisable to guarantee every period slip casting deadline).By high-pressure rubber pipe 3 grouting pump 2 is connected with stake limit Grouting Pipe 6 or stake heart Grouting Pipe 11, prepares slip casting.
The segmentation from bottom to top of whole slip casting process is carried out continuously, begin slip casting from stake 4 ends of grout hole, limit first, after the first paragraph grouting amount of stake limit Grouting Pipe 6 reaches the result of calculated in advance, from radial grouting hole 7 and the cement paste 13 that outpours of tangential injected hole 8 reach design attitude.Then, utilize rig 1 lifting stake limit Grouting Pipe 6 to next slip casting section, hoisting depth is 1500mm, then carries out next section slip casting, to the last promotes also slip casting and arrives till the position, aperture.After stake limit grout hole 6 is finished slip casting, utilize cement paste 13 to block grout hole.Stake heart Grouting Pipe 11 is directly inserted 10 ends of stake heart grout hole, when the cement paste 13 that outpours from normal direction injected hole 12 reaches the design grouting amount, cement paste 13 is filled with castinplace pile subsoil body just, and be connected as a single entity with cement paste 13 that stake limit grout hole 4 is annotated, like this, finish a slip casting at 10 ends of heart grout hole with regard to disposable.
Along with finishing of each grout hole slip casting and sealing of hole, the cement paste that is injected by each grout hole is connected as a single entity, and after the sclerosis, formation has circular cup-shaped cylindrical shell water stopping function, firm in the vertical of castinplace pile periphery and the bottom soil body.
